My comment back in 1999: Suzanne Levinson was the first to make a business selling ‘the authentic Belgian fries’ on the streets in New York. She started her first outlet in 1997 and owns 2 at the moment (as far as I know). I never met her…. Maybe next time, Suzanne?
Prices in 1999: $3.00 for a regular, $4.25 for large and $5.50 for a double portion.
